Donald Addison Ricker, 66, of Chester passed away on Thursday, November 27, 2025. Born February 26, 1959, he was the son of the late Irwin Chester and Hazel Leslie Ricker.
He is survived by his loving wife of 31 years, Carol Ricker; children, Melissa Ricker-Curran, Matthew Ricker, Mitchell Ricker and wife, Stephanie, Jessica Von Gehr and husband, Erich, Krystal McKenzie; nine grandchildren; two brothers, Stephen Ricker and wife, Carol, Keith Ricker and wife, Susan; two sisters, Carol Bungay and husband, Ron, Amy Lange; beloved cat, Buddy; numerous nieces nephews and other extended family members.
Donald spent 30 years with the Department of Defense, retiring as a project manager with the Defense Commissary Agency. He took great pride in his work and in the path that led him there. One of his proudest accomplishments was earning his Bachelor of Science in Computer and Information Systems from the University of Maryland.
He brought that same sense of purpose into his community, volunteering for the Chesterfield/Colonial Christmas Mother program for a decade. He believed deeply in helping families in need and never hesitated to give his time to make someone’s season brighter.
At home, Donald was known for a few great loves, his two Dodge Challengers, his cat Buddy, and his beloved Carol. The family often joked that he adored them in exactly that order. His cars were his pride, Buddy was his shadow, and Carol was his heart.
